Hello all-

Below are logs from AVG Anti-Spyware (which I probably should have run in Safe Mode; the report is from a normal startup) and HT.
This computer can only browse the Web from Internet Explorer. Whenever I try Firefox or the internal updates in AVG AV or Anti-Spyware they fail immediately, telling me that they cannot get on the Internet as if a firewall were blocking them access.
There was an "anti-spam weather utility" installed as well as a MyWebSearch tool bar, but I think I've gotten rid of those. I've run several Spybot S&D scans and cleaned up the results.
There were also two suspicious processes running: ishost.exe and ismini.exe. I rebooted into Safe Mode and removed the registry entries to launch ishost.exe at startup, rebooted, and removed both executables.
Edit: I also downloaded and ran CWShredder, but it found nothing.
I've done manual updates (as of today) for AVG AV & Anti-Spyware and for Spybot S&D, since they cannot get on the Internet to update themselves.
AVG Anti-Virus cleaned up several instances of Downloader.Agent.GVC and Downloader.Zlob.FNK.

Nevermind... I managed to clean it up. A bad (old & expired) install of Norton Internet Security was the culprit when it came to not letting me on the Internet. Using Symantec's removal tool cleaned up that mess.
